Degree Overview: Bachelor of Business Administration (B.B.A.) Degree in Operations Management

Majors Overview March 17, 2014

Students that participate in Bachelor of Business Administration (B.B.A.) degree programs in Operations Management will be prepared to run technical or production operations. These programs will help students gain the skills necessary to make systems in production run efficiently.

B.B.A. Programs in Operations Management

Individuals who seek occupations with a public company or private business would benefit by earning a Bachelor of Business Administration degree in Operations that is devised to provide knowledge in subject areas such as information technology, quality management and materials management. The emphasis of these 4-year programs is on the decision-making aspect of business and may include coursework in inventory analysis, planning, quality control, and project management.

Admission criteria typically require incoming students to hold a GED certificate or high school diploma.

Coursework

Core coursework in BBA programs typically includes subject areas in business, such as management, finance and marketing; students are also afforded the opportunity to choose a concentration. Coursework may focus on mathematical methods and be devised to help develop complex production plans. Coursework may include specific topic areas such as:

•Accounting
•Human resource management
•Statistics for business
•Microeconomics
•Management and organization
•Supply chain management
•Quantitative methods
•Quality management
•Management information systems

Career Choices

Graduates from a BBA in Operations Management program can choose from numerous entry-level career options in business including:

•Storage and distribution manager
•Supply chain manager
•Operations manager

Continuing Education Choices

After they complete bachelor’s programs in Operations Management, graduates may seek continued education by earning a master of business administration (M.B.A.). Schools offer these programs in full- and part-time formats with coursework in finance, marketing, supply chain management and accounting. Online options are featured by some programs in accordance with the needs of working individuals. It can take 1-2 years to complete these programs that include summer sessions. Students may be able to choose from concentrations in innovation management, corporate finance or supply chain management.
